File: /home/undanet/www/PortalEmpleo/src/Entity/DboConvocatoriarequisito.php
<?php
namespace PortalEmpleo\Entity;
use Doctrine\ORM\Mapping as ORM;
/**
* DboConvocatoriarequisito
*
* @ORM\Table(name="dbo_convocatoriarequisito", indexes={@ORM\Index(name="FK_convocatoriarequisito_convocatoria_idx", columns={"CodigoConvocatoria"})})
* @ORM\Entity
*/
class DboConvocatoriarequisito
{
/**
* @var int
*
* @ORM\Column(name="IdConvocatoriaRequisito", type="integer", nullable=false)
* @ORM\Id
* @ORM\GeneratedValue(strategy="IDENTITY")
*/
private $idconvocatoriarequisito;
/**
* @var string
*
* @ORM\Column(name="Requisito", type="string", length=200, nullable=false)
*/
private $requisito;
/**
* @var string
*
* @ORM\Column(name="Descripcion", type="string", length=200, nullable=false)
*/
private $descripcion;
/**
* @var bool
*
* @ORM\Column(name="Baja", type="boolean", nullable=false)
*/
private $baja;
/**
* @var \DboConvocatoria
*
* @ORM\ManyToOne(targetEntity="DboConvocatoria", fetch="EAGER", cascade={"merge"})
* @ORM\JoinColumns({
* @ORM\JoinColumn(name="CodigoConvocatoria", referencedColumnName="IdConvocatoria")
* })
*/
private $codigoconvocatoria;
/**
* @var bool
*
* @ORM\Column(name="Obligatorio", type="boolean", nullable=true)
*/
private $obligatorio;
/**
* Get the value of idconvocatoriarequisito
*
* @return int
*/
public function getIdconvocatoriarequisito()
{
return $this->idconvocatoriarequisito;
}
/**
* Set the value of idconvocatoriarequisito
*
* @param int $idconvocatoriarequisito
*
* @return self
*/
public function setIdconvocatoriarequisito(int $idconvocatoriarequisito)
{
$this->idconvocatoriarequisito = $idconvocatoriarequisito;
return $this;
}
/**
* Get the value of requisito
*
* @return string
*/
public function getRequisito()
{
return $this->requisito;
}
/**
* Set the value of requisito
*
* @param string $requisito
*
* @return self
*/
public function setRequisito(string $requisito)
{
$this->requisito = $requisito;
return $this;
}
/**
* Get the value of descripcion
*
* @return string
*/
public function getDescripcion()
{
return $this->descripcion;
}
/**
* Set the value of descripcion
*
* @param string $descripcion
*
* @return self
*/
public function setDescripcion(string $descripcion)
{
$this->descripcion = $descripcion;
return $this;
}
/**
* Get the value of baja
*
* @return bool
*/
public function getBaja()
{
return $this->baja;
}
/**
* Set the value of baja
*
* @param bool $baja
*
* @return self
*/
public function setBaja(bool $baja)
{
$this->baja = $baja;
return $this;
}
/**
* Get the value of codigoconvocatoria
*
* @return \DboConvocatoria
*/
public function getCodigoconvocatoria()
{
return $this->codigoconvocatoria;
}
/**
* Set the value of codigoconvocatoria
*
* @param DboConvocatoria $codigoconvocatoria
*
* @return self
*/
public function setCodigoconvocatoria2(DboConvocatoria $codigoconvocatoria)
{
$this->codigoconvocatoria = $codigoconvocatoria;
return $this;
}
/**
* Set the value of codigoconvocatoria
*
* @param int $codigoconvocatoria
*
* @return self
*/
public function setCodigoconvocatoria(int $codigoconvocatoria)
{
$v = new DboConvocatoria();
$v->setIdconvocatoria($codigoconvocatoria);
$this->codigoconvocatoria = $v;
return $this;
}
/**
* Get the value of obligatorio
*
* @return bool
*/
public function getObligatorio()
{
return $this->obligatorio;
}
/**
* Set the value of obligatorio
*
* @param bool $obligatorio
*
* @return self
*/
public function setObligatorio(bool $obligatorio)
{
$this->obligatorio = $obligatorio;
return $this;
}
}